Key Insights of Japan Sodium Bisulfite Solution Market
-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$250 million, reflecting steady industrial demand and environmental compliance needs.
- Forecast Value (2026): Projected to reach $350 million, driven by expanding applications in water treatment and pulp bleaching.
- CAGR (2026–2033): Approximately 5.8%, indicating a resilient growth trajectory amid global supply chain shifts.
- Leading Segment: Water treatment accounts for over 45% of total demand, with significant contributions from pulp and paper processing and textile industries.
- Core Application: Primarily used for dechlorination, bleaching, and preservation, with increasing adoption in environmental remediation.
- Leading Geography: The Kanto region dominates with over 40% market share, leveraging industrial clusters and infrastructure.
- Key Market Opportunity: Rising environmental regulations and sustainable manufacturing practices open avenues for innovative, eco-friendly formulations.
- Major Companies: Sumitomo Chemical, Mitsubishi Chemical, and Tosoh Corporation lead market share, focusing on R&D and strategic partnerships.

FAQs: Common Inquiries About Japan Sodium Bisulfite Solution Market
What are the primary applications of sodium bisulfite in Japan?
Sodium bisulfite is mainly used for water treatment, pulp bleaching, photographic processing, and food preservation, with increasing applications in environmental remediation.
